KSGC 2025 Crowns India’s Konnect as World Winner
On the Ok-Startup Grand Problem (KSGC) 2025 Demo Day, held on December 11 at COEX Seoul throughout COMEUP 2025, India’s Konnect was named the general winner amongst 2,626 groups from 97 international locations—the biggest participation in this system’s historical past.
The occasion, organized by Korea’s Ministry of SMEs and Startups (MSS) and the Korea Institute of Startup & Entrepreneurship Growth (KISED), marked a pivotal milestone in Korea’s inbound innovation coverage because it celebrated this system’s tenth anniversary.
Konnect is constructing a data-driven authentication and fee platform that addresses challenges confronted by international residents and vacationers in Korea. The startup obtained KRW 100 million (roughly USD 74,000) in prize funding and goals to develop its platform right into a complete way of life ecosystem, protecting authentication, fee, settlement, and comfort providers.
World Founders Showcase Borderless Innovation
The Demo Day highlighted eight finalist groups representing numerous frontier applied sciences, from AI and automation to sustainable manufacturing and next-generation fintech.
Second place went to MaimHaim (United States), which mixes inertial measurement sensors (IMU) and encrypted token programs to create contactless check-in and fee options for automated services. Third place was awarded to Pierrot Firm (Canada), creating a international IT asset circulation platform that reuses idle units via data-based redistribution.
The prime 20 groups will proceed into Part 3 of the KSGC program, receiving three months of post-competition assist, together with open innovation collaboration with Korean corporates, investor IR alternatives, and workspace entry to speed up their settlement and scaling within the Korean market.
KSGC: A Decade of Constructing Korea’s World Startup Gateway
Launched in 2016, KSGC has advanced into certainly one of Asia’s most outstanding international acceleration packages. Over the previous decade, it has supported 449 worldwide groups, helped set up 226 native companies, and facilitated 425 startup visas, positioning Korea as a launchpad for international founders in search of entry to Asia’s superior tech financial system.
The 2025 version additionally marked a brand new stage of integration with COMEUP, Korea’s largest startup pageant. The alignment introduced higher visibility and engagement with buyers, policymakers, and company innovation companions, reinforcing KSGC’s place as a strategic coverage instrument for worldwide entrepreneurship.
